Lake Erie Company uses a plantwide overhead rate with machine hours as the allocation base. Next year, 600,000 units are expected to be produced taking 0.75 machine hours each. How much overhead will be assigned to each unit produced given the following estimated amounts?Estimated:Department 1Department 2Manufacturing overhead costs$3,107,500 $1,520,000 Direct labor hours 150,000DLH 250,000DLHMachine hours 250,000MH 175,000MH

A. $5.61 per unit
B. $11.57 per unit
C. $12.43 per unit
D. $10.89 per unit
E. $8.17 per unit


Answer: E
